About Spickard, MO

Spickard is a city in Missouri, located in Grundy County. The city spans 1 ZIP code and is home to approximately 861 residents. It is a mature city, with a median age of 48.9 years.

Economically, Spickard is a solidly middle-class community. The median household income of $55,500 is below the national average. Approximately 16.5% of residents live below the poverty line. The unemployment rate is 3.8%, below the national average.

The real estate market in Spickard is one of the more affordable housing markets in the country. Median home values stand at $108,300, which is well below the national average. Homeownership is high at 73.6%, typical of suburban and family-oriented communities.

The population of Spickard is less-educated. 24.4%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her — below the national average. The community is primarily White (98.49%).
